What is a SIPP?

A Self-Invested Personal Pension (SIPP) is a type of pension scheme that allows you to have greater control over your investment decisions Unlike traditional personal pensions, which are typically managed by pension providers and invest in a limited range of assets, a SIPP allows you to choose from a wider range of investment options, including stocks, bonds, mutual funds, and commercial property This flexibility gives you the opportunity to tailor your pension investments to suit your individual financial goals and risk tolerance.

Benefits of Transferring a Personal Pension to a SIPP

There are several benefits to transferring your personal pension to a SIPP, including:

1 Investment Control: With a SIPP, you have the freedom to choose how your pension pot is invested This can allow you to take advantage of market opportunities and potentially achieve higher returns compared to traditional pension schemes.

2 Diversification: By investing in a wider range of assets through a SIPP, you can diversify your portfolio and reduce the risk of having all your eggs in one basket This can help protect your pension savings from market volatility and economic downturns.

3 Lower Fees: Some personal pensions come with high management fees, which can eat into your overall retirement savings By transferring to a SIPP, you may be able to access lower-cost investment options and keep more of your money working for you.

4 Retirement Income Flexibility: When you reach retirement age, a SIPP offers more flexibility in how you can access your pension savings You can choose to take a tax-free lump sum, purchase an annuity, or opt for flexible drawdown options to provide a regular income in retirement.

How to Transfer a Personal Pension to a SIPP

If you decide that transferring your personal pension to a SIPP is the right move for you, the process is relatively straightforward transfer personal pension to sipp. Here are the steps you’ll need to follow:

1 Research SIPP Providers: Start by researching different SIPP providers to find one that offers the investment options, fees, and level of customer service that best meet your needs It’s essential to compare fees, investment choices, and customer reviews before making a decision.

2 Contact Your Pension Provider: Get in touch with your current pension provider to request a transfer value statement This document will show the current value of your pension fund and any potential charges or penalties for transferring to a SIPP.

3 Open a SIPP Account: Once you’ve chosen a SIPP provider, you’ll need to open an account with them You may need to complete an application form and provide identification documents to verify your identity.

4 Initiate the Transfer: Complete the necessary transfer forms provided by your SIPP provider and submit them along with the transfer value statement from your personal pension provider The transfer process can take several weeks to complete, so it’s essential to keep track of the progress and follow up if necessary.

5 Monitor Your Investments: Once your personal pension has been successfully transferred to your SIPP, you can begin managing your investments and monitoring their performance It’s a good idea to review your investment strategy regularly and make adjustments as needed to stay on track towards your retirement goals.
